Comparing Nutrients in 300 calories Unsweetened Rice MilkVS Dried Butternuts
Weight per 300 calories
Unsweetened Rice Milk
638g
Dried Butternuts
49g
Dried Butternuts have 13 times more energy per unit of mass than Unsweetened Rice Milk, which is very high in comparison to other foods. Unsweetened Rice Milk having low energy density.

Lets compare vitamin content per 300 calories of Unsweetened Rice Milk vs Dried Butternuts:
300 calories of Unsweetened Rice Milk have 136.7 times more Vitamin A, 12.5 times more Vitamin B2, 4.9 times more Vitamin B3, 3 times more Vitamin B5, more Vitamin B12 and more Vitamin D than Dried Butternuts.
While 300 kcal of Dried Butternuts contain 2.5 times more Vitamin B9 than Unsweetened Rice Milk.
Both Unsweetened Rice Milk and Dried Butternuts provide similar amounts of Vitamin B1 and Vitamin B6 per 300 calories.
300 calories of Unsweetened Rice Milk have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B9
300 calories of Dried Butternuts have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B2, Vitamin B3,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D
Both Unsweetened Rice Milk as well as Dried Butternuts have insufficient amounts of Vitamin C in 300 calories.
Comparing minerals per 300 calories for Unsweetened Rice Milk vs Dried Butternuts:
300 calories of Unsweetened Rice Milk have 29 times more Calcium, 1.6 times more Phosphorus, 1.7 times more Selenium, 507.8 times more Sodium and 348.1 times more Water than Dried Butternuts.
While 300 kcal of Dried Butternuts contain 1.5 times more Iron, 1.7 times more Magnesium, 1.8 times more Manganese and 1.8 times more Zinc than Unsweetened Rice Milk.
Both Unsweetened Rice Milk and Dried Butternuts contain similar levels of Copper per 300 calories.
300 calories of Unsweetened Rice Milk lack sufficient amounts of Potassium
300 calories of Dried Butternuts lack sufficient amounts of Calcium
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 300 calories:
300 calories of Unsweetened Rice Milk have 9.9 times more Carbohydrate than Dried Butternuts.
While 300 kcal of Dried Butternuts contain 4.5 times more Fat, 83.7 times more Omega 3, 8.5 times more Omega 6 and 6.8 times more Protein than Unsweetened Rice Milk.
Both Unsweetened Rice Milk and Dried Butternuts offer comparable quantities of Energy per 300 calories.
300 calories of Unsweetened Rice Milk provide inadequate amounts of Omega 3, Fiber and Protein
300 calories of Dried Butternuts provide inadequate amounts of Carbohydrate
